#dcbdad - One to Remember color
A soft, muted almond-beige that reads warm and slightly sun‑worn. It blends creamy tan with a gentle peachy-pink undertone, producing a comforting, vintage feel rather than a bright or stark tone. Subdued and elegant, it evokes dried florals, linen textiles, and natural materials—calming in interiors, flattering in fashion, and grounding in graphic palettes. It pairs beautifully with sage green, warm gray, and deep walnut for a quietly sophisticated palette.
#dcbdad color RGB value is 220, 189, 173, and the CMYK value is 0.00, 0.141, 0.214, 0.137. Alternative names for that color are: one to remember, tan, zinnwaldite, desert sand, orange.
